Konitsa is a town in the municipality of Konitsa in the prefecture of Ioannina, Epirus, Greece.

The population of the town was 2871 inhabitants while that of the municipality 6225, according to the 2001 census.

During the Greek Civil War, Konitsa became a prime objective of the Communist forces who sought to make it the capital of the territories they held. Between December 25, 1947 and January 3, 1948, a fierce battle raged around the town in which the Communist forces of the Democratic Army of Greece were repelled with heavy casualties.
